Thomas wanted to have a party to celebrate becoming a decade old. Knowing the meaning of the Greek root deca, how old is Thomas?

Respuesta :

vaduz
vaduz vaduz
  • 18-04-2021

Answer:

Thomas is 10 years old.

Explanation:

The word "decade" is derived from the Greek root word "deca" meaning 'a group of ten'. So, we can easily assume that any word with that root word will be related to the number 10.

Thomas wants to celebrate his becoming a decade older. This means that Thomas is ten years old. The word "decade", means a number of ten years, or a period of ten years.

Thus, Thomas is 10 years old.
